Site Cleaning in Utah County, UT
Site cleaning services encompass a range of projects aimed at restoring and maintaining the cleanliness of residential properties, including yards, driveways, patios, decks, and outdoor structures. These services are often requested to remove dirt, debris, stains, moss, algae, or other buildup that can accumulate over time, especially after storms or seasonal changes. Homeowners typically seek site cleaning to enhance curb appeal, prepare for events or renovations, or simply to keep outdoor spaces safe and inviting. Before requesting service, property owners should consider the specific areas they want cleaned, the types of debris or stains involved, and any particular concerns such as delicate surfaces or landscaping that may require special attention.
Understanding the scope of a site cleaning project is essential for homeowners and property owners. Clarifying whether the work involves power washing, debris removal, or surface treatments can help ensure the right services are selected. It’s also useful to know the condition of the surfaces to be cleaned, as some materials may require gentle approaches to prevent damage. Property owners are encouraged to communicate any specific expectations or restrictions, such as avoiding certain chemicals or protecting plants, to help facilitate an effective and thorough cleaning process.

Site Cleaning Questions
What types of sites can be cleaned? Site cleaning services typically cover residential properties, commercial buildings, construction sites, and outdoor areas needing debris removal.
What surfaces or areas are included? Services often include cleaning of driveways, walkways, patios, decks, and exterior walls, as well as interior spaces if requested.
How often should site cleaning be scheduled? The frequency depends on the project's scope and property needs, ranging from one-time cleanups to regular maintenance.
What are common reasons to request site cleaning? Property owners often seek site cleaning after construction, landscaping projects, or to prepare a site for new development or sale.
